Stable Heat Level Uniformity

Maintaining stable temperatures ranks as the primary advantage of a dedicated wine storage unit. Fluctuations in cold expose stoppers to contraction, allowing air infiltration that induces oxidation. A high-quality wine cooler eradicates this risk by maintaining settings usually between 45°F and 65°F, adjustable for red or sparkling types. Such accuracy secures every vessel remains at its perfect storage state perpetually.

Standard refrigerators function at colder temperatures, often around 37°F, which stifles taste evolution and makes tannins harsh. Additionally, their regular operation creates damaging swings in internal environment. A wine cooler’s compressor-based system neutralizes this by delivering steady chilling without abrupt drops, preserving the quality of aged bottles.

Humidity Control Fundamentals

Adequate moisture levels play a pivotal function in avoiding cork deterioration. If corks dehydrate, they contract, permitting oxygen intrusion that spoils the vino. Conversely, high dampness promotes mold formation on labels and materials. A engineered wine cooler sustains 50-80% relative moisture, a spectrum impossible to attain in dry cabinet environments.

Such equilibrium is achieved via integrated humidity controls that monitor and regulate readings seamlessly. In contrast to regular appliances, which remove dampness from the air, wine coolers preserve necessary wetness to keep closures pliable and airtight. This function is especially vital for long-term aging, where minor deviations cause irreversible loss.

Protection from Light and Vibration

UV rays and vibrations present subtle yet significant risks to wine quality. Contact to natural light breaks down organic elements in wine, resulting in early deterioration and "unpleasant" flavors. Moreover, persistent shaking disturb sediment, hastening molecular processes that diminish complexity. A wine refrigerator mitigates these problems with UV-resistant doors and stabilized mechanisms.

Premium models incorporate insulated doors that filter 99% of harmful UV light, establishing a light-controlled environment for stored bottles. Simultaneously, advanced compressor technologies utilize shock-absorbing mountings or thermoelectric configurations to minimize motor tremors. This dual safeguarding ensures delicate years stay untouched by outside forces.

Energy Efficiency and Sustainability

Modern wine coolers emphasize power conservation absent sacrificing performance. Advances like low-energy illumination, enhanced sealing, and variable-speed compressors significantly reduce power usage compared to older models. Several units carry ENERGY STAR® certifications, indicating compliance to strict ecological guidelines.

Such economy translates to long-term cost savings and a reduced carbon impact. Contrary to standard refrigerators, which operate repeatedly, wine coolers activate refrigeration solely when necessary, preserving temperatures with low power consumption. Furthermore, sustainable refrigerants minimize atmospheric depletion, resonating with environmentally aware values.
